<p>While some mother-daughter duos might be content with an afternoon spent at Bergdorf, <strong>Anne Eisenhower</strong> (a granddaughter of the former president) and fille <strong>Adriana Echavarria </strong>like to buy Park Avenue co-ops together.</p>
<p>The socialites apparently share more than a presidential pedigree—city records show they inked their names on the deed of a 2-bedroom, 2-bath spread on the 17th floor of <strong>799 Park Avenue</strong>.<!--more--></p>
<p>It is unclear if mother and daughter will reside together in the lofty space a la <em>Grey Gardens</em> (fortunately, the "unparallelled sunlight and views to the north, east, and south" touted in the listing, held by Prudential Douglas Elliman broker <strong>Claire Ratusch </strong>will help to alleviate the sense of cloying claustrophobia documented in the Maysles brothers film). More likely, it's for Ms. Echavarria alone, or a shared <em>pied-a-terre</em> for the women, who are well-known on the New York charity circuit.</p>
<p>In any event, Ms. Eisenhower likely had some cash to burn after selling her <a href="http://online.wsj.com/article/SB10001424052748704457604576011911688990794.html?KEYWORDS=hamptons">$35 million historic mansion</a> in Southhampton back in 2010. And at <strong>$1.85 million</strong>, this aerie hardly makes a dent. The co-op was purchased from <strong>Dennis</strong> and <strong>Coralie Paul</strong>, who have been trying to sell it since 2009, when they listed it at $2.45 million, gradually dropping the ask to $1.89 million. The couple purchased the apartment for $1.75 million in 2006. Apparently, back in 2009, Ethernet jacks in every room were considered cutting edge. "The electrical wiring has been completely overhauled with a new transformer box and energy-saving Lutron switches, preparing you and this hi-tech apartment for the technological demands of the future," boasts the listing so you can "take care of business in style."</p>
<p>The Pauls—<a href="http://www.hauteliving.com/2007/07/women-of-substance/">sometimes called the most gorgeous couple in New York</a>—apparently wanted a space that better suited their spectacular selves or their growing family. And as <a href="http://observer.com/2002/06/countdown-to-bliss-118/">Coralie Paul, nee Charriol</a>, is the heiress to Southeast Asia's Charriol luxury brand empire and Mr. Paul works in money management, they can probably afford the upgrade.</p>
